The turbocharger market's expansion is primarily driven by the tightening global emission standards for vehicles and machinery. Governments worldwide are implementing stricter regulations to curb greenhouse gas emissions, pushing manufacturers to adopt technologies that enhance fuel efficiency and reduce pollutants. Turbochargers play a crucial role in achieving this goal by improving engine performance without significantly increasing fuel consumption. The automotive industry, being the largest consumer of turbochargers, is a significant driver of market growth. The rising demand for fuel-efficient vehicles, particularly in developing economies with expanding middle classes, further fuels this trend. Moreover, the increasing popularity of smaller displacement engines equipped with turbochargers to enhance power output contributes significantly to the market's expansion. The construction and engineering machinery sectors also contribute considerably, as these industries increasingly adopt more efficient and powerful engines incorporating turbochargers to improve productivity and reduce operating costs. Finally, advancements in turbocharger technology, such as the development of more efficient and durable designs, are also boosting market growth. The ongoing research and development efforts focused on reducing turbo lag, improving responsiveness, and enhancing overall efficiency are driving the adoption of newer and more advanced turbocharger systems.
Despite the positive growth trajectory, the turbocharger market faces several challenges. The high initial cost of turbocharger systems can be a barrier to adoption, especially in price-sensitive markets. The complexity of turbocharger design and manufacturing also presents hurdles for smaller players aiming to enter the market. Maintaining high quality standards and ensuring the longevity of turbocharger components are crucial, as failures can lead to costly repairs and downtime. Furthermore, the increasing demand for electric vehicles (EVs) presents a potential long-term challenge to the turbocharger market, although hybrid and plug-in hybrid vehicles still utilize turbocharged internal combustion engines (ICEs). The cyclical nature of the automotive industry, which is susceptible to economic downturns and fluctuations in consumer demand, also impacts the overall demand for turbochargers. Lastly, intense competition among manufacturers necessitates continuous innovation and cost optimization to maintain profitability and market share. Navigating supply chain disruptions and securing access to raw materials are also key challenges in the dynamic global market landscape.
